Based on their faq: https://www.tiktok.com/support/faq_detail?category=web_accou... > You shouldn't see mature or complex themes, such as: > • Profanity > • Sexually suggestive content > • Realistic violence or threatening imagery > • Firearms or weapons in an environment that isn't appropriate > • Illegal or controlled substances/drugs > • Explicit references to mature or complex themes that may reflect personal experiences or real-world events that are intended for older audiences It is clearly described as a content filter. (It also deactivates gifting on live and "following" feed.) | ||||||||||||||||||||
